Hilfe ---> Dialog

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• ocmd:admhelp(playerid,params[])
    {
    if(!isPlayerAnAdmin(playerid,1))return SendClientMessage(playerid,ROT,"Du bist kein Admin.");
    ShowPlayerDialog(playerid,DIALOG_ADMHELP,DIALOG_STYLE_INPUT,"AdminHilfe","AdminLevel 1 = Supporter | AdminLevel 2 = Admin | AdminLevel 3 = Community-Leitung \n Ab AdminLevel 1: \n /kick = kicken \n /tvon = TvPlayerOn \n /tvoff = TvPlayerOff \n /goto = teleportieren \n /godon/off = GodMode \n /adutyon/off = On/OffDuty gehen \n /sv = SpawnVehicle \n /dv = DestroySpawnVehicle \n /repair = RepairVehicle \n /flip = Flip dein Auto \n /tc = ServerTeamChat \n Ab AdminLevel 2: \n /ban = bannen \n /respawnallcars \n Ab AdminLevel 3: \n /restart = Neustart via gmx \n /setadmin = Admin/Supporter machen","Ok");
    return 1;
    }


    Ich bekomme dort 5 errors :O


    C:\Users\Nico\Desktop\SAMP Server\gamemodes\360script.pwn(920) : error 075: input line too long (after substitutions)
    C:\Users\Nico\Desktop\SAMP Server\gamemodes\360script.pwn(921) : error 027: invalid character constant
    C:\Users\Nico\Desktop\SAMP Server\gamemodes\360script.pwn(921) : error 017: undefined symbol "AdminLevel"
    C:\Users\Nico\Desktop\SAMP Server\gamemodes\360script.pwn(921) : error 022: must be lvalue (non-constant)
    C:\Users\Nico\Desktop\SAMP Server\gamemodes\360script.pwn(921) : fatal error 107: too many error messages on one line

  • ocmd:admhelp(playerid,params[])
    {
    if(!isPlayerAnAdmin(playerid,1))return SendClientMessage(playerid,ROT,"Du bist kein Admin.");
    ShowPlayerDialog(playerid,DIALOG_ADMHELP,DIALOG_STYLE_MSGBOX,"AdminHilfe","AdminLevel 1 = Supporter | AdminLevel 2 = Admin | AdminLevel 3 = Community-Leitung \n Ab AdminLevel 1: \n /kick = kicken \n /tvon = TvPlayerOn \n\
    /tvoff = TvPlayerOff \n /goto = teleportieren \n /godon/off = GodMode \n /adutyon/off = On/OffDuty gehen \n /sv = SpawnVehicle \n /dv = DestroySpawnVehicle \n /repair = RepairVehicle \n /flip = Flip dein Auto \n /tc =\
    ServerTeamChat \n Ab AdminLevel 2: \n /ban = bannen \n /respawnallcars \n Ab AdminLevel 3: \n /restart = Neustart via gmx \n /setadmin = Admin/Supporter machen","Ok","");
    return 1;
    }
    So?

    "Bevor ich mir Informationen aus der "Bild" hole,
    werde ich anfangen, Wahlergebnisse danach vorauszusagen,
    neben welchen Busch unsere Katze gepinkelt hat."

    Margarete Stokowski

  • Pack da ein String eventuell rein? Dann wirds auch angezeigt. Oder wo liegt dein Problem?

  • Dann pack mal weniger rein und erstell für jedes Admin Level ein Dialog.?

  • versuch mal indem du das hier " \n /tvon = TvPlayerOn \n /tvoff = TvPlayerOff \n /goto = teleportieren \n /godon/off = GodMode \n /adutyon/off = On/OffDuty gehen \n /sv = SpawnVehicle \n /dv = DestroySpawnVehicle \n /repair = RepairVehicle \n /flip = Flip dein Auto \n /tc = ServerTeamChat \n Ab AdminLevel 2: \n /ban = bannen \n /respawnallcars \n Ab AdminLevel 3: \n /restart = Neustart via gmx \n /setadmin = Admin/Supporter machen" rausnimmst



    /edit sry bisschen unübersichtlich ^^

  • Zum ersten mal mit Dialogen gearbeitet?


    hinter \n Kommt sofort der "Satz" der dann kommt ohne Leerzeichen


    also aus

    \n /tvoff

    wird
    \n/tvoff

  • ocmd:admhelp(playerid,params[])
    {
    if(!isPlayerAnAdmin(playerid,1))return SendClientMessage(playerid,ROT,"Du bist kein Admin.");
    ShowPlayerDialog(playerid,DIALOG_ADMHELP,DIALOG_STYLE_MSGBOX,"AdminHilfe","AdminLevel 1 = Supporter | AdminLevel 2 = Admin | AdminLevel 3 = Community-Leitung\nAb AdminLevel 1: \n/kick = kicken\n/tvon = TvPlayerOn\n/tvoff = TvPlayerOff\n/goto = teleportieren\n/godon/off = GodMode\n/adutyon/off = On/OffDuty gehen\n/sv = SpawnVehicle\n/dv = DestroySpawnVehicle\n/repair = RepairVehicle\n/flip = Flip dein Auto\n/tc = ServerTeamChat\nAb AdminLevel 2:\n/ban = bannen\n/respawnallcars\nAb AdminLevel 3:\n/restart = Neustart via gmx\n/setadmin = Admin/Supporter machen","Ok");
    return 1;
    }


    habs jetzt so und immer noch 5 Fehler.